Oregon's frequent rainfall and moderate temperatures encourage the growth of moss, algae, and lichen on roofs, siding, and driveways, especially in the Willamette Valley. Wooden homes, common in Portland and Beaverton, are particularly susceptible to moisture damage and require gentle yet effective cleaning. Stucco and vinyl siding also accumulate grime and biological growth over time. Our power washing process is designed to address these specific issues without damaging the underlying materials.

The primary distinction lies in the water temperature: power washing uses heated water, while pressure washing uses unheated water. Heated water is more effective at breaking down stubborn substances like grease and oil. Both methods use high-pressure water to clean surfaces. The most effective power washing strategy begins with a careful evaluation of the surface material. We then select the appropriate pressure and nozzle, often starting low and increasing as needed. Using appropriate cleaning agents and working systematically from top to bottom prevents streaking and ensures thorough coverage. Our technicians are trained in these optimal methods.
